Sharp Basio Active specifications
Brand | Sharp |
---|---|
Name | Basio Active |
Model | BASIOACT |
Release date | 2023 |
Weight, dimensions, colors
Weight | 6.14 oz |
---|---|
Dimensions | 6.22 x 2.8 x 0.37 inch |
Colors | navy, red, silver |
SIM type | Nano SIM |

System, chipset, performance
OS version | Android OS v12.0 |
---|---|
SoC | Qualcomm Snapdragon 695 |
CPU | Octa-core, Dual-core 2.2 GHz Kryo 660, Hexa-core 1.7 GHz Kryo 660 |
GPU | Adreno 619 |

Display type, size, resolution
Display type | IPS |
---|---|
Screen size | 5.7 inch |
Resolution | 720 x 1520 px |
Multitouch support | yes |

Memory, storage
RAM | 4 GB |
---|---|
Internal storage | 64 GB |
Memory card slot | microSD |

Cameras, flash
Main camera | 12 MP, 4032 x 3024 px, autofocus |
---|---|
Flash | LED |
Selfie camera | 8 MP |

Connectivity, network, wireless
GSM 2G bands | 850 / 900 / 1800 / 1900 |
---|---|
Network coverage | 2G / 3G / 4G / 5G |
Wi-Fi | Wi-Fi 802.11 a/b/g/n/ac |
Bluetooth | v5.1, A2DP |
GPS | A-GPS, GLONASS |
NFC | no |
FM radio | no |
USB | USB Type-C |
Headphone | 3.5 mm jack |

Battery type, capacity, charger
Type | Li-Ion 4000 mAh, non-removable |

Features, sensors, specials
Sensors | accelerometer, fingerprint, gyroscope, light, proximity |
---|---|
Specials | Certified IP68 dustproof and waterproof, Fast charging |
